Deleting the program files won't kill it as it'll have added itself some regestry keys so it can come back from the grave, also System Restore will probably be a pain for you, as has already been suggested use adaware, and maybe Spybot Search and Destroy and maybe the Windows Malicious Software Removal Tool.
